A leading audit and consultancy firm is offering an Audit Graduate Programme that starts in September 2026. The role provides hands-on experience across diverse clients while studying for a recognised ACA, CFAB, or ICAS qualification.

Candidates with a minimum 2:2 degree and three A-levels are encouraged to apply. The program promotes professional development and prepares graduates for long-term careers within the firm.

Candidates must be within commuting distance of the Glasgow or Edinburgh offices, and relocation support is not provided.
